Materials & Craftsmanship
Each rug is individually hand-knotted on a cotton foundation. Artisans tie thousands of knots one-by-one, then shear the pile to an even finish. This slow traditional process creates sharp motifs, strong edges, and a rug that can last decades with proper care.

Trust & Care
Because every rug is hand-knotted, slight variations in color and pattern are natural signs of authenticity. Vacuum gently, rotate occasionally, and avoid direct sunlight for long life.
